10 Essential Clean Code Tips for Developers
Writing clean code is a crucial skill for developers, ensuring that your code is not only functional but also easy to understand, maintain, and extend. Clean code can significantly reduce the time needed for debugging and future development. Here are ten essential tips to help you write cleaner code and become a more efficient developer.
1. Meaningful Naming Conventions
Choosing the right names for variables, functions, and classes is the first step in writing clean code. A well-named variable can help convey its purpose without the need for additional comments. For instance, use totalPrice
instead of tp
. Follow consistent naming conventions like camelCase or snake_case based on your language’s guidelines.
2. Write Small Functions
Functions should do one thing and do it well. Small, focused functions are easier to test, debug, and understand. Aim to keep functions under 20 lines of code. If a function grows too large, consider breaking it down into smaller helper functions.
3. Use Comments Wisely
Comments are useful when explaining why a piece of code exists, not what it does. Code should be self-explanatory through meaningful names and clear structure. Over-commenting can lead to clutter and maintenance issues as comments can become outdated after code changes.
4. Consistent Indentation
Consistent indentation improves readability and helps maintain a structured visual hierarchy in your code. Whether you use spaces or tabs, choose one and stick with it throughout your project. Many IDEs offer auto-formatting tools to help maintain consistency.
5. DRY Principle (Don’t Repeat Yourself)
Avoid duplicating code by abstracting repeated logic into functions or classes. Repeated code can lead to inconsistencies and makes maintenance more challenging. By following the DRY principle, you ensure that changes need to be made in only one place.
6. Code Formatting and Style Guides
Adopt a coding style guide for your project. This guide should include conventions for naming, spacing, and organization. Popular style guides are available for most programming languages, like PEP 8 for Python and Google’s JavaScript Style Guide.
7. Error Handling and Logging
Robust error handling is crucial for developing reliable applications. Always anticipate potential errors and handle them gracefully. Additionally, implement logging to track errors and application flow, which helps in debugging and monitoring the application’s health.
8. Optimize for Readability
Code is read much more often than it is written. Therefore, prioritize readability over cleverness. Use straightforward logic, break down complex expressions, and use whitespace effectively to separate logical blocks within your code.
9. Test-Driven Development (TDD)
Writing tests before your code can ensure you cover edge cases and meet requirements. TDD encourages cleaner code by forcing developers to consider how code will be used from a testing standpoint. It also promotes modular design, as you typically write testable code.
10. Regular Code Reviews
Participating in code reviews allows developers to learn from each other and ensure consistency across codebases. Reviews can catch issues early and encourage collaborative learning. Use tools like GitHub’s pull requests to facilitate effective code reviews.

FAQ
What are some key clean code principles?
Some key clean code principles include writing readable and understandable code, keeping functions small and focused, using meaningful names for variables and functions, and avoiding unnecessary complexity.
Why is writing clean code important for developers?
Writing clean code is important because it improves code readability and maintainability, reduces the likelihood of bugs, facilitates easier collaboration among team members, and enhances the overall quality of the software.
How can developers ensure their code is easily readable?
Developers can ensure their code is easily readable by using consistent formatting, writing descriptive comments where necessary, choosing meaningful names for variables and functions, and keeping code simple and concise.
What role does code refactoring play in clean coding?
Code refactoring plays a crucial role in clean coding as it involves restructuring existing code without changing its external behavior, thereby improving its readability, efficiency, and maintainability.
How can developers avoid unnecessary complexity in their code?
Developers can avoid unnecessary complexity by adhering to the KISS principle (Keep It Simple, Stupid), breaking down complex problems into smaller, manageable parts, and avoiding over-engineering solutions.
What are some common mistakes to avoid for clean coding?
Common mistakes to avoid include writing overly complex code, neglecting code documentation, failing to adhere to consistent coding standards, and ignoring the importance of code reviews and testing.
